• China Joins the Hague System
    China has joined theHague System bringing the total number of countries covered to 94. The Government of China deposited its instrument of accession to the1999 Geneva Act of the Hague Agreementon February 5, 2022.   • China-Portugal (Portugal) Patent Prosecution Highway (PPH) Experiments Extended for Another Five Years
    According to the joint decision of CNIPA and INPI, China-Portugal (Portugal) Patent Prosecution Highway (PPH) Experiments will be extended for another five years from January 1, 2022 until December 31, 2026. Relevant requirements and process of submitting PPH requests in the two sides will remain unchanged.   • China files more patent applications than US
    China's intellectual property office led the world last year by reporting 1.5 million patent applications, 2.5 times more than the United States, which ranked second, the World Intellectual Property Organization said on Monday.   • China Hosts ID5/TM5 Annual Meetings Online
    The China National Intellectual Property Administration (CNIPA) hosted the 2021 Industrial Design 5 (ID5) and Trademark 5 (TM5) annual meetings online from November 1 to 5. Both groups, which comprise competent authorities from China, the U.S., EU, Japan and the Republic of Korea, concluded their joint statements after reaching consensus at the meetings.
